China Shopping Mall Toilet Poop 2
File Size: 2.04 Gb
Resolution: 720x1280
Duration: 01:07:25
Nelion:
File Size: 2.04 Gb
Resolution: 720x1280
Duration: 01:07:25
Nelion:
Download China Shopping Mall Toilet Poop rar
Download File China Shopping Mall Toilet Poop rar
nelion.me